Hi,
After "configure --with-your-options" and "make":
You must modify:
config.status
config_vars.mk
and replace:
.....apxs -S LIBEXECDIR....
flag
with -L flag.
Then "make install" again.

[2001-06-30 05:29:45] [EMAIL PROTECTED]
I use Apache 1.3.2 on a Cobalt RaQ2
I used:
./configure --with-mysql --with-apxs --with-enable-track-vars
make also didn't give any problems.
make install gives an error:
make[1]: Entering directory `/home/tmp/php4/php-4.0.6'
/home/tmp/php4/php-4.0.6/build/shtool mkdir -p "/usr/lib/apache" &&
/usr/sbin/ap
xs -S LIBEXECDIR="/usr/lib/apache" -i -a -n php4 libs/libphp4.so
apxs:Error: Unknown option: S
Usage: apxs -g -n <modname>
apxs -q <query> ...
apxs -c [-o <dsofile>] [-D <name>[=<value>]] [-I <incdir>]
[-L <libdir>] [-l <libname>] <files> ...
apxs -i [-a] [-n <modname>] <dsofile> ...
make[1]: *** [install-sapi] Error 1
make[1]: Leaving directory `/home/tmp/php4/php-4.0.6'
make: *** [install-recursive] Error 1
